Fertilizing is basic to supporting plant health and achieving rich, dynamic landscapes. Plants require a well balanced supply of nutrients-- mostly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ce abundant blossoms, and preserve lively foliage. A soil test is the primary step in determining what nutrients are lacking, ensuring that the chosen fertilizer fulfills the particular needs of the site. Fertilizers are available in different kinds, consisting of granular, liquid, natural, and synthetic, each providing different release rates and advantages. Applying the ideal type at the right time is vital to prevent nutrient runoff, root burn, or unequal development. Seasonal timing, such as using higher n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, helps plants get ready for development spurts or hold up against winter season tension. Consistent fertilization not only enhances plant look however likewise reinforces resilience versus pests, diseases, and environmental stress factors. A well-fed landscape is most likely to prosper year after year, offering both charm and eco-friendly worth
